Information - South East Area Committee meeting

Area Committees give you the chance to influence Council decision-making, share your opinion and contribute to positive changes in your neighbourhood. As a resident of Ipswich, this is your opportunity to say what you would like to see improved.

Ipswich is divided into five areas, and each of those areas are split into wards. There are three councillors per ward, representing you, a resident of that area. Councillors work with residents, businesses and community groups at these public meetings to discuss how money can be spent and how the area can be improved. You can ask questions.

Click the link to find out more about your councillors, and for details of this and future meetings. Agendas are released a week before each meeting and, if you want to ask a question, you should email it in at least 2 days before the meeting.
